The era witnessed the embrace of a wide array of social and economic reforms, including … WebPart 1: In the early 1800's, motor-powered machines replaced manual labor for the making of products. Factories became very popular and began to spring up everywhere in the United States. Factory owners found a new and cheaper source of labor to manage their machines, children. Operating the machines did not require a lot of skills or strength. how to create a stem leaf plot
